Carborundum Universal Limited, together with its subsidiaries, manufactures and sells abrasives, ceramics, and electrominerals in India and internationally. It operates through three segments: Surface Engineering, Technical Ceramics and Super Refractory Solutions, and Electrominerals. The company offers super, bonded and coated abrasives, cutting and grinding, metal working fluids, and power tools; and electro minerals, such as alumina, carbides, zirconia, and grit powders. It also provides industrial ceramics for applications in mining and mineral processing, power and energy systems, mobility, semiconductors and electronics, and aerospace and defence; and manufactures super refractories, including dense bonded, insulating bonded, monolithics, pre-cast prefired components, acid-resistant liners comprising carbon bricks, advanced composites, specialty screeding and coatings, polymer concrete cells, and structural composites, including piping for abrasion resistance; and graphene, phase change materials, high-purity silicon carbide, and specialty polymers. In addition, the company offers IT infrastructure facility management, software application development, remote infrastructure management, and IT security management services; and operates gas-based power generation facility. Carborundum Universal Limited was incorporated in 1954 and is based in Chennai, India.

Profitability ratios are a class of financial metrics that are used to assess a business's ability to generate earnings relative to its revenue, operating costs, balance sheet assets, and shareholders' equity over time, using data from a specific point in time.
The return on equity signifies how well the management is running the company in terms of capital management. The ideal return on equity is greater than 10%. The return on equity is calculated as net income divided by total share holders equity.
